How to use FTP to transfer files

This picture tutorial will show you how to use Internet Explorer and FTP (File Transfer Protocol) to upload your files from your computer to your web hosting account.

Requirements: Most web browsers will allow you to FTP, but this tutorial is using Internet Explorer 6.0.

Step 1:

  1. Open your web browser and enter your FTP address (provided by your web host) into the address bar.
  2. Click "Go".

Step 2:

You will be presented with a login page. Enter your user name and password.

If you are not presented with the login screen, but you get an access denied error, then try clicking "File | Login As", so that the login box will display.

Step 3:

After you login, you can see the files and folders in your FTP location, at the remote server. From this point forward you can copy and paste files from your computer to your remote location, just as if you were copying them to another folder on your own computer. You can also do the reverse and copy files from the remote server to your own computer.

Important:

Aquest Hosting customers are given an FTP address which goes to your account root. Once you connect to that address, you will see a folder named for your domain. For example, if your domain name is "abc.com", then you will see a folder called "abccom" (there's no period in the folder name). That folder is your website folder (aka: website root folder). Accounts with multiple websites will have several of these folders named for their domains.

Double-click the domain folder to open it.

In your domain folder, you will see several default folders, and a temporary default web page (default.htm) we placed there. This is where you will upload your website.

Just to clarify, your website files must sit inside the folder that has your domain name.
